Output 5624c35524b463b6f962ad83ecedfb8e51cd67028002e8f4a2807a95c6de57e3:1

value
128289090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b74bb6ad04caa550afd7f64b20d90b9221691ade OP_EQUALVERIFY OP_CHECKSIG
address
1HiBMn3MQG7P1gTswMgFabPqv4hazGQtZ6
transaction
5624c35524b463b6f962ad83ecedfb8e51cd67028002e8f4a2807a95c6de57e3
spent
true